Jhulan Goswami gradually moves up the ladder despite misogynistic politics to fulfill her dream of playing cricket for India. Her goal: the India women's ICC World Cup final against mighty England at the Lord's on 23 July 2017.
2019
1949
1926
1922
—
1928
1924
2005
2023
1911
2007
2024
2015
2025
1972